花式游泳 huā shì yóu yǒng (Tw) synchronized swimming
Chinese Pinyin Translation Actions
花样游泳 花樣游泳 huā yàng yóu yǒng synchronized swimming
水上芭蕾 shuǐ shàng bā lěi synchronized swimming
